The Ta Phraya National Park was declared a National Park in 1996. The park covers an area of 371,250 rai (equivalent to 594 sq.km.).
The area surrounding the park and the boundary of the park form a straight line connecting Pangsida National Park from the west to Cambodia in the east. In the north, the park is connected to Tab Lan National Park and Burirum province. This is also where the administrative offices of the park are located.
How to get there
By Bus From Aranyaprathet, take the Aranyaprathet – Buri Ram bus for approximately 1 hour to Wat Khao Chong Tako which is opposite the Office of the National Park.
By Other Take Highway 33, passing Mueang Sa Kaeo District and Watthana Nakhon District. At Aranyaprathet District, turn left into Highway 348 around Km. 76, approximately 27 kilometres passing Ta Phraya District, the entrance to the Office of the National Park will be seen. It is a laterite road stretching for 13 kilometres to the Office.
